Definitely pick up Iron X for using after Tardis. Don't clay your car with using a tar remover. Clay isn't for removing tar.

Alex a word of caution about using Tripple under Zaino if that was the plan. The finish will be stunning but it might compromise the durability of the Zaino a little.
Johnny at Zaino will tell you the same of course. Just incase the Zaino fails a bit quicker than say 6 months it may be because...
